How Hot Is It Inside A Pressure Cooker. A pressure cooker can deliver a moist and tender roast in about 30 minutes. The pressure level is the most significant factor influencing the temperature. The temperature inside a pressure cooker can reach up to 250°f to 300°f (121°c to 149°c) depending on the pressure level, which is. Higher pressure settings result in higher temperatures. The device traps hot steam inside, which helps to cook the food faster.
